首页 > 解决方案 > 如何在更改自定义帖子类型 slug 后使用 .htaccess 进行 301 重定向

问题描述

例如,在更改自定义帖子类型 slug 后,我需要有关 301 重定向的帮助 - 我已使用 rewrite 标记将 funcation.php 中的自定义帖子类型 slug“portfolio_page”更改为“portfolio-page”,现在我想重定向所有帖子有“portfolio_page/post-name”的slug到“portfolio-page/post-name”。

谢谢

标签: wordpress.htaccess

解决方案


如果对自定义帖子类型的更改有效(可以在 /portfolio-page/post-name 上访问这些页面)并且您只想将 /portfolio_page/post-name 重定向到 /portfolio-page/post-name,让我们比如说,让旧 URL 的访问者转到新 URL:阅读:htaccess 在 url 中重写 slug

如果您无权访问您的 .htaccess,您还可以使用可用于 wordpress 的重定向插件,请参阅:https ://nl.wordpress.org/plugins/redirection/


推荐阅读